You can get in with a buggy here without a fight — access is step-free, so no doorway negotiations before you've even sat down. High chairs and a proper kids' menu mean a toddler is genuinely accounted for rather than tolerated, and gluten-free options are there if someone in your group needs them. It's a lively room, which is good news if your two-year-old has opinions at volume. Worth booking ahead, and at ££ it sits in mid-range territory for a smarter meal out in Newark.
